I am merging from a dbf file that has a field were the dollar amount is
carried out 9 places because of sales taxes. Example $185.050000001.
How can I make Word2003 change this to regular dollars and cents? To
round up to two places.

Also can you caculate in Word mail merge? Example: Balance field -
credits field times sales tax?

I round by right clicking on the field, then toggling used the toggle field
code command. Then follow the instructions on
http://www.gmayor.com/formatting_word_fields.htm

When you click update, you get the original field name back
